At the age of 73, Prime Minister Modi was inaugurated for his third term as India’s Prime Minister, thus matching the record set by Jawaharlal Nehru. Nehru was India’s first prime minister and served three consecutive terms in 1952, 1957, and 1962. Accordingly, Prime Minister Narendra Modi, along with 72 other members of the new coalition administration, took their oaths of office on Sunday. Among them, thirty assume roles as Cabinet Ministers, five hold independent charges, and 36 are designated as Ministers of State.
